VDOT is excited to announce a competitive opportunity to serve as the Division Administrator of the Local Assistance Division. The selected Senior Transformational Leader will drive change and deliver solutions that support the agency’s Local Assistance Division.
This position will be located in Richmond, Virginia. The selected candidate will provide leadership and direction for the VDOT's Local Assistance Program, direct and provide day to day VDOT wide leadership in the development, execution and evaluation of local transportation assistance programs and projects. This role will establish program goals and ensure appropriate execution and performance of program activities and compliance with applicable laws and regulations.
